Cotton Fingers Tour To Play Northern Ireland, Republic of Ireland and Cardiff!

National Theatre Wales’ Cotton Fingers, written by award-winning writer Rachel Trezise at the time of the historic referendum of the 8th amendment in Ireland, will be performed at venues in Belfast, Derry, Dublin, Bray and Cardiff during May and June 2019.

Amy Molloy will perform in the bold, one-woman show directed by Julia Thomas, which looks at cycles of secrecy and the power young women hold over their futures.

Aoife is hungry and in need of something to do.
Cillian makes a mean cheese toastie.
As Aoife’s boredom and hunger are satisfied by half an hour in Cillian’s bed, her life changes forever.
Smart and funny, Aoife knows there’s more out there for her. She just doesn’t know what it is yet.
As social and political upheaval grips the country she loves, can Aoife regain control over her future?

Cotton Fingers was originally performed in west Wales during July 2018 and is one of five monologues or Love Letters to the National Health Service that formed part of NTW’s NHS70 Festival, celebrating the Service’s 70th birthday.
